they have never installed hood switch and i tested to make sure wire not reading ground.this model had a toggle switch also that book says needs to see ground to operate so they have that grounded permenent.brain has power,tested ign acc wires. brain clicks and flash lights in program mode,remote learn,tach learn etc but hit start and no flash,click nothing.i even ordered a used brain on ebay andsame  thing???im not real familiar w cars that dont use start wire and couldnt find much info on the sec bypass it has but are there any that need to be reproggramed after loss of power? and if so would start still attempt to start like on older cars? thanks

As long as the R/S's ignition outputs timing is correct ( ACC and IGN come on
simultaneously ) and then ACC drops while the Starter output goes to +12V, the
engine should crank.  If the Passlock2 bypass is not working, it should still
crank but without fuel pressure it won't start / run.  What type of bypass module
is installed?

I am not familiar with Code Alarm systems but try turning Diagnostics ON ( Feature 6 )
and see what type of error you are getting on a remote start attempt.

Strange problem.  Not familiar with that bypass module, either. 

You probably already tried this but...

Check to see if the thick Pink IGN1 has +12V on it with the car off.  ( It shouldn't )

Pull both fuses ( Red and RED / Violet wires ) and do a continuity check on them
with your DMM.   Re-insert fuses and verify +12V at the Red and RED / Violet wires
at the CA 420 connector.

Verify with your DMM that :
Pin 4 Gray/Black does not show chassis ground
Pin 7 Gray does not show chassis ground
Pin 9 Brown does not show +12V
Pin 10 BROWN / Red does not show +12V

Double check the CA 420 chassis ground connection.  Should be with a soldered terminal ring to a clean, paint free, solid metal frame bolt.

Switch to Tachless mode and try a remote start.
